Go to the official websiteDevelia S.A.: core business model
Develia S.A. specializes in real estate development, primarily targeting the residential segment in Poland. The company acquires land, plans projects, obtains permits, constructs buildings, and sells or leases units. Its model emphasizes high-quality urban developments in growing cities, with a pipeline exceeding 5,000 residential units planned or under construction as reported in investor materials on Develia IR as of 2026.
This integrated approach allows Develia to control costs and timelines from inception to delivery. The firm also ventures into commercial properties, including office spaces and retail outlets, diversifying revenue streams. Main revenue and product drivers for Develia S.A.
Residential sales form the bulk of Develia's revenue, driven by demand for apartments in Poland's major cities. In recent periods, the company has delivered thousands of units annually, with pricing supported by urban migration and low interest rates prior to recent hikes. Commercial leasing provides stable income from office and retail assets.
Land banking and project pre-sales are key to cash flow management. Develia secures financing through bank loans and equity, maintaining a solid balance sheet. Industry trends and competitive position
Poland's real estate sector benefits from EU funds and infrastructure spending, boosting demand for new housing. Develia competes with peers like Echo Investment and Dom Development, standing out via its focus on premium locations and sustainable building practices. The market faces headwinds from rising construction costs and mortgage rates, yet long-term urbanization supports growth.
